Understanding the Core Gameplay of Chicken Road
At its heart, chicken road is about risk versus reward. The primary objective is to navigate a chicken across lanes of oncoming traffic, collecting corn kernels along the way. These kernels contribute to the player’s score and can be used to unlock new and unique chicken characters, adding a layer of customization and collectibility. However, each successful crossing increases the speed of the traffic and number of vehicles, escalating the difficulty. The game thrives on its simple control scheme – typically a single tap or swipe to move the chicken between lanes – making it accessible to anyone, but true mastery requires precise timing and an understanding of traffic flow.
The game’s appeal isn’t just its ease of play. It’s the constant tension and the thrill of narrowly avoiding collisions. One moment of inattention can lead to a disastrous end, yet the quick restart time encourages players to jump right back in and try again. This cycle of near misses and eventual successes creates an incredibly rewarding loop, perfectly suited for short bursts of gameplay on the go. The strategic element comes into play when deciding when to prioritize corn versus avoiding imminent danger.
| Objective | Guide a chicken across a busy highway. |
| Controls | Simple tap or swipe to change lanes. |
| Rewards | Collect corn to increase score and unlock characters. |
| Difficulty | Increases with game progress (speed and traffic). |
Strategies for Maximizing Your Score in Chicken Road
Achieving a high score in chicken road requires more than just luck. Several strategies can significantly improve your chances of survival. First, observing traffic patterns is crucial. Not all lanes are created equal, and predicting which lane will be clear for a longer duration is essential. Second, prioritize corn collection strategically. While maximizing points is important, don’t jeopardize your chicken’s safety for a few extra kernels.
Another effective tactic is learning to anticipate the movements of specific vehicle types. Trucks and buses, for example, tend to maintain a consistent speed, while smaller cars may be more erratic. Understanding these differences allows players to make more informed decisions. Moreover, memorizing the spawn points of vehicles provides a significant advantage, enabling players to react faster to potential threats. And lastly, mastering the timing of lane changes is paramount. A split-second delay can mean the difference between survival and a feathered demise.
